2026年CMS开发的核心学习路径已从单一的前后端编码转向“低代码平台二次开发+AI辅助生成+云原生架构设计”的复合型能力体系,掌握Vue3/React生态、Node.js后端及大模型API集成是构建高排名CMS的关键。

随着搜索引擎算法向语义理解与用户体验深度倾斜,传统的静态页面生成器已无法满足2026年的SEO需求,企业级CMS不再仅仅是内容发布工具,而是集内容管理、用户互动、数据追踪于一体的智能中枢,对于开发者而言,单纯记忆语法已无意义,构建系统化的知识图谱才是突围之道。
前端技术栈:响应式与组件化的深度重构
在2026年的前端开发环境中,静态站点生成器(SSG)与服务端渲染(SSR)已成为CMS前端的主流选择,为了提升首屏加载速度(FCP)和交互延迟(INP),开发者必须精通现代框架。
核心框架与状态管理
- Vue3或React 18+:这是构建CMS管理后台的基石,Vue3的组合式API(Composition API)在处理复杂表单验证和内容字段动态渲染时具有显著优势,特别适合国内开发习惯。
- 状态管理:掌握Pinia(Vue生态)或Zustand(React生态),CMS涉及大量实时数据同步,如多用户协作编辑、草稿自动保存,轻量级且高性能的状态管理库是必备技能。
- UI组件库:熟悉Ant Design Vue或Element Plus,这些库提供了丰富的表格、树形控件和富文本编辑器集成方案,能大幅缩短后台开发周期。
SEO友好的渲染策略
- SSR/SSG集成:学习Next.js(React)或Nuxt3(Vue),通过预渲染技术,确保搜索引擎爬虫能直接抓取完整的HTML内容,解决传统SPA(单页应用)SEO权重低的问题。
- 结构化数据注入:在前端组件中动态注入JSON-LD格式的结构化数据,帮助百度识别文章类型、作者信息及评分,提升搜索结果中的富摘要展示概率。
后端与架构:云原生与AI驱动的智能化
后端是CMS的大脑,2026年的CMS后端开发强调高并发处理能力和AI内容的自动化生成与管理。

语言选型与API设计
- Node.js (NestJS):推荐选择NestJS框架,它基于TypeScript,具备严格的模块化和依赖注入特性,适合构建大型、可维护的企业级CMS后端,其RESTful API与GraphQL的双支持,能灵活应对前端不同场景的数据请求。
- Go语言:对于超高并发场景(如电商大促期间的CMS内容同步),Go语言的高并发处理能力成为新宠,适合微服务架构下的独立服务开发。
AI集成与自动化工作流
- 大模型API对接:学习如何调用百度文心一言、通义千问等国内主流大模型API,实现功能包括:自动生成文章摘要、智能标签推荐、多语言自动翻译及SEO标题优化。
- 向量数据库:引入Milvus或ChromaDB,用于存储文章嵌入向量,实现基于语义的智能内容检索和相关推荐,提升用户停留时长(Dwell Time),间接利好SEO排名。
数据库与存储:性能优化与安全合规
数据库的选择直接影响CMS的查询效率和数据安全性。
关系型与非关系型结合
| 数据类型 | 推荐技术 | 应用场景 |
|---|---|---|
| 结构化数据 | PostgreSQL | 用户信息、订单记录、文章元数据(支持JSONB字段,兼顾灵活性与规范) |
| 缓存与热点数据 | Redis | Session存储、热点文章缓存、分布式锁(防止并发编辑冲突) |
| 全文检索 | Elasticsearch | 站内搜索、复杂条件筛选、日志分析 |
数据安全与合规
- 数据加密:遵循《个人信息保护法》要求,对用户敏感信息(手机号、身份证)进行AES-256加密存储。
- 权限控制:实现RBAC(基于角色的访问控制)模型,细化到字段级权限,防止越权访问和恶意篡改。
DevOps与部署:自动化运维体系
2026年的CMS开发离不开自动化运维的支持,确保代码从提交到上线的无缝衔接。
- Docker容器化:将CMS前后端及依赖服务(Nginx, DB, Redis)打包为Docker镜像,实现环境一致性,消除“在我机器上能跑”的问题。
- Kubernetes编排:对于大型CMS集群,使用K8s进行容器编排,实现自动扩缩容,应对流量高峰。
- CI/CD流水线:利用GitLab CI或GitHub Actions,配置自动化测试、代码扫描和部署流程,提高发布频率和稳定性。
实战建议与资源推荐
对于初学者或转型开发者,建议遵循“最小可行性产品(MVP)”原则,不要试图一次性构建完美的CMS,而是先实现核心的“创建、读取、更新、删除(CRUD)”功能,再逐步集成AI和SEO优化模块。

学习路径推荐
- 基础阶段:精通HTML5/CSS3/JavaScript,掌握Vue3或React基础。
- 进阶阶段:学习Node.js后端开发,理解RESTful API设计,掌握PostgreSQL基本操作。
- 高阶阶段:深入Docker/K8s,学习AI API集成,研究SEO底层逻辑与结构化数据。
常见问题解答(FAQ)
Q1: 2026年学习CMS开发,选择Java还是Node.js更好?
A: 若侧重传统企业级大型系统且团队熟悉Java生态,Spring Boot仍是稳健之选;若追求快速迭代、前后端统一语言(JavaScript/TypeScript)及AI集成便利性,Node.js (NestJS)更具优势,尤其在中小型CMS和SaaS平台中更受欢迎。
Q2: 自建CMS与使用WordPress相比,SEO效果有差异吗?
A: 技术本身不决定SEO,代码质量、加载速度和内容结构才决定,WordPress插件众多但易臃肿,自建CMS可通过精简代码、定制SSR策略获得更快的加载速度和更灵活的SEO控制,长期来看更利于排名,但初期开发成本较高。
Q3: CMS开发中如何平衡内容安全与发布效率?
A: 引入审核API进行初筛,结合人工审核机制,建立敏感词库和合规检查流程,确保内容符合《网络信息内容生态治理规定》,在保障安全的前提下,通过自动化工作流提升发布效率。
互动引导: 你在CMS开发中遇到的最大痛点是性能优化还是AI集成?欢迎在评论区分享你的实战经验。
参考文献
- 百度搜索引擎优化指南(2026版). 百度搜索引擎优化指南项目组. 2026.
- 中国互联网络信息中心(CNNIC)第57次中国互联网络发展状况统计报告. 中国互联网络信息中心. 2026.
- 《现代Web应用架构:从单体到微服务》. 王小明, 李华. 人民邮电出版社. 2025.
- 《AI驱动的内容管理系统:技术架构与实践》. 张强. 计算机学报. 2026.
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/471383.html


评论列表(1条)
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是掌握部分,给了我很多新的思路。感谢分享这么好的内容!